About Latitude Group Holdings Ltd
Latitude Group Holdings Ltd (ASX: LFS) is an Australian-based financial services company. It offers loans, consumer finance, credit cards, and insurance, also servicing customers in New Zealand, Canada, and Singapore.
In March 2023, Latitude Group announced it was subject to a cyber attack in which Australian and New Zealand customer data was breached. The attack was subsequently revealed to be worse than first reported. The incident sparked a plunge in the company's share price.
